Abstract

Cavitation-induced loading oscillations are mainly responsible for the pump vibration, the excitation source identification of which is critical for the control of pump vibration. The water-tunnel experiments and numerical simulations are conducted to study the pump cavitation under the wake flow perturbation of inlet guide vanes. Meanwhile, an excitation source identification method based on second-order statistics is proposed, which connects the blade loading distribution and the overall thrust considering physical causality. Combined with the mode decomposition, the loading distribution of pump cavitation with a dominant energy contribution can be effectively revealed. The results showed that the temporal-spatial characteristics of inflow incidence angle largely regulate the development and distribution of blade cavitation. The correlation modes with amplitude can represent the energy contribution. The normalized correlation modes can represent the similarity between variables. For the cavitation condition, it is found that the whole part from the blade middle to the hub contributes much to the thrust oscillations through excitation source identification based on the second-order statistics, which is dominated by low frequency. However, only the cavitation-induced loading oscillations can be extracted by first-order statistics.
